            |  | A BILL TO BE ENTITLED | 
         
            |  | AN ACT | 
         
            |  | relating to the deadline for approving a certificate of public | 
         
            |  | convenience and necessity for certain transmission projects. | 
         
            |  | B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: | 
         
            |  | SECTION 1.  Section 37.057, Utilities Code, is amended to | 
         
            |  | read as follows: | 
         
            |  | Sec. 37.057.  DEADLINE FOR APPLICATION FOR NEW TRANSMISSION | 
         
            |  | FACILITY.  The commission must approve or deny an application for a | 
         
            |  | certificate for a new transmission facility not later than the | 
         
            |  | 180th day after [ the first anniversary of] the date the application | 
         
            |  | is filed.  If the commission does not approve or deny the | 
         
            |  | application on or before that date, a party may seek a writ of | 
         
            |  | mandamus in a district court of Travis County to compel the | 
         
            |  | commission to decide on the application. | 
         
            |  | SECTION 2.  The changes in law made by this Act apply only to | 
         
            |  | a proceeding affecting a certificate of public convenience and | 
         
            |  | necessity that commences on or after the effective date of this Act. | 
         
            |  | A proceeding affecting a certificate of public convenience and | 
         
            |  | necessity that commenced before the effective date of this Act is | 
         
            |  | governed by the law in effect on the date the proceeding is | 
         
            |  | commenced, and that law is continued in effect for that purpose. | 
         
            |  | SECTION 3.  This Act takes effect immediately if it receives | 
         
            |  | a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as | 
         
            |  | prov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ution.  If this | 
         
            |  |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this | 
         
            |  | Act takes effect September 1, 2023. |
